// Client setup for the Glintframe snapshot service.
// UI component snapshots are rendered remotely and diffed against the
// approved baseline set; mismatches page on-call via the render-diff
// alert. If you are responding to a snapshot storm, check whether a
// baseline purge ran recently — most pages trace back to that, not to
// real regressions. Re-approving baselines requires write scope on
// this client. It authenticates to Glintframe using the service key
// appended below.

API key for yahig-tadup: kto7_ubizbYm

A: The app stores tour progress locally and mirrors it to the Hallbridge sync service every 90 seconds. On reinstall, the restore flow in `TourStateRestorer` prompts for the account's recovery credentials before pulling the mirrored snapshot. Reviewers should note that the snapshot is encrypted client-side, so the server never sees plaintext bookmarks. Test accounts on the staging tier skip email verification entirely. For the shared staging account, use the passphrase below.

vault phrase of bahop-yahaf = novael-ralir-gilox-praeth

**Action item: close the SDK parity gap (Kestrel-JS vs Kestrel-Go)**

Hey on-call — during Tuesday's incident we learned the hard way that the Go SDK for the Kestrel platform ships with different retry and timeout defaults than the JS one, so identical client code behaved totally differently under the outage. Action item is to align both SDKs on a single blessed set of defaults and add a parity test to CI so they can't drift again. The agreed canonical values are:

tuning table, yajog-yahof:
BUDGETS = {
    "lamvan": 303,
    "wenox": 460,
    "fenvan": 525,
}

## Configuration

SquatterWatch scans package registries for typo-squatting lookalikes of our internal libraries. Support staff running local triage should copy `env.sample` to `.env` and review each value carefully before starting the daemon. The scanner will refuse to start without registry credentials. To enable authenticated registry queries, add this line to your `.env` file:

sealed setting: COURIER_KEY8=0dbae41b